How good is IAMS dog food?

IAMS was founded in 1946 in Ohio, USA; most products sold domestically are now produced by Shanghai Royal Pet Food Co. To meet different ages and sizes, IAMS offers small-breed adult, medium-large breed adult, and large-breed puppy lines. In terms of ingredients, IAMS may fall short of premium standards: its animal protein comes mainly from meat meal, and it adds wheat, barley, wheat flour, rice, and other grains. If your budget allows, a fresh-meat or high-end imported food is preferable.

How good is Jialezhi dog food?

Jialezhi is reportedly developed in Japan and formulated as a complete dog food for the Chinese market. It is divided by life stage into puppy, adult, and senior formulas. However, nutritionally it is not very high: the first two ingredients in every formula are corn and wheat, the animal protein is chicken meal, and corn gluten meal is added to boost crude protein. Its fiber source is beet pulp, a low-value sugar-industry byproduct with anti-nutritional factors, so it should not be overfed.

How good is Youlang dog food?

Youlang was founded in 2013 and is a relatively niche, affordable domestic brand. It has two lines: New Hope Youlang complete dog food and Youlang senior dog food; the New Hope line also comes in 'cooling' and 'coat-care' formulas. Its main advantage is fresh meat as the primary protein source, with no plant protein or legumes added, and fairly complete fiber, minerals, and vitamins. However, it contains several grains (rice, wheat, corn), so it may not suit dogs with sensitive stomachs.

How good is Bigetai dog food?

Bigetai is an affordable dog food from Bigetai Pet Food Co., selling for just a few yuan per jin online. With no official flagship store, specifics on ratios, additives, and sourcing cannot be verified, so its exact quality is hard to judge. Based on price and ingredients, its nutritional value is likely low; we recommend choosing a higher-quality, more palatable food.
